Abstract

The utility model belongs to the technical field of vegetable production, and particularly relates to a cleaning device for a vegetable production line, which comprises a machine base, wherein the top of the machine base is fixedly connected with a water inlet device, one side, which is close to the inside of the water inlet device, is fixedly connected with a connecting pipe, the outer surface of the connecting pipe is fixedly connected with a plurality of high-pressure spray heads, the front surface of the water inlet device is fixedly connected with a water injection pipe, and the left side of the bottom of the water injection pipe is fixedly connected with a purifier. Background
Vegetables are a plant or fungus which can be cooked and become food, and are one of the indispensable foods in people's daily diet. The vegetables can provide nutrients such as vitamins and minerals essential to human body. The surface of the vegetables just picked is adhered with impurities such as soil, and when some vegetable raw materials are processed and produced by some food factories, the vegetables are often required to be cleaned so as to remove dust impurities in the vegetables, and the cleaned vegetables are cleaner and sanitary. In the vegetable processing production process, cleaning is an important process.
The existing cleaning device usually cleans through stirring in a cleaning barrel, the vegetable is damaged sometimes due to overlarge stirring force in the use of the cleaning mode, and meanwhile, a large amount of impurities falling off from the vegetable can be mixed in the cleaning liquid in the cleaning process, but the device is sealed and cannot be timely discharged, so that partial impurities remain on the surface after the vegetable is cleaned, the cleaning efficiency of the vegetable is reduced, the cleaning effect is greatly reduced, and the subsequent use process of the vegetable is influenced.
The cleaning device for the vegetable production line disclosed in the Chinese patent CN212065622U drives vegetables to move in the box body through the rotation of the roller, so that the vegetables are washed by the spray head, the brush layer is driven by the rotating shaft to brush the surfaces of the vegetables by combining with cleaning water, meanwhile, a plurality of groups of brushes are arranged in the device, and the vegetables are turned over when the front side brushes are brushed, so that the other side of the vegetables is conveniently cleaned by the rear side brushes, the vegetables can be more comprehensively cleaned, and the cleaned vegetables become cleaner and are convenient for people to eat; the user can add the medicament that needs to use in to the storage water tank through the water filling port to carry out more thorough cleanness to vegetables, the collecting vat can collect waste water after wasing, avoids its turbulent flow to produce the influence to external environment, and the filter plate can collect the dish leaf that drops in wasing simultaneously, so that reuse to it.
However, the device has the advantages that the efficiency is low when the vegetables with a large number are washed, and the sludge which is easy to fall off from the vegetables before the vegetables are washed cannot be pretreated.
Therefore, there is a need to provide a cleaning device with high cleaning efficiency for vegetable production lines.
Disclosure of Invention
The utility model aims to provide a cleaning device for a vegetable production line, which aims to solve the problems that the efficiency is low when a large number of vegetables are cleaned and the sludge which is easy to fall off from the vegetables cannot be pretreated before the vegetables are cleaned in the prior art.
In order to achieve the above purpose, the present utility model provides the following technical solutions: the cleaning device for the vegetable production line comprises a machine base, wherein a water inlet device is fixedly connected to the top of the machine base, a connecting pipe is fixedly connected to one side, which is close to the inner side, of the water inlet device, a plurality of high-pressure spray heads are fixedly connected to the outer surface of the connecting pipe, a water injection pipe is fixedly connected to the front surface of the water inlet device, a purifier is fixedly connected to the left side of the bottom of the water injection pipe, a water storage tank is fixedly connected to the right side of the bottom of the water injection pipe, a discharge hole is formed in the surface of the right side of the machine base, and a transmission device is arranged in the right side of the machine base;
the conveying device comprises a driving motor, a driving box is connected to the left bottom of the driving motor, a rotary drum is connected to the inner side surface of the driving box in a rotating mode, a crawler belt is connected to the outer surface of the rotary drum in a transmission mode, a baffle is fixedly connected to the outer surface of the crawler belt, a feeding port is fixedly connected to the top of the left side of the machine base, and a rotary drum is fixedly connected to the inner side of the feeding port.
Preferably, the frame is internally provided with a support, filter plates are fixedly connected to two sides of the support, a plurality of filter holes are formed in the outer surfaces of the filter plates, leak holes are formed in the bottoms of the support, a fixing seat is fixedly connected to the right side surface of the support, and the water source washed down can be filtered through the filter holes and flows into the water storage tank for reuse.
Preferably, the purifier and the water storage tank are fixedly connected with the outer surface of the machine base, so that water purified by the purifier flows into the water storage tank through the water injection pipe.
Preferably, the rotary drum penetrates through the machine base and is rotationally connected with the driving box, so that the motor is prevented from influencing normal use in the machine base.
Preferably, the baffle has a plurality of numbers, and with certain distance and track fixed connection, makes the vegetables quantity that drops evenly distributed on the track, avoids piling up.
Preferably, the outer surfaces of the two sides of the rotary drum are rotationally connected with the fixed seat fixed on the surface of the support, so that the fixing effect of the rotary drum in the support is better.
Preferably, the number of the rotating drums is four, and the rotating drums are fixedly connected with the inner wall of the feed inlet at a certain angle, so that vegetables roll step by step after being poured from the feed inlet, and large-area dirt particles on the surface are shaken out and then fall to the crawler belt.

When the vegetable washing machine is used, the driving motor 901 is electrified, the driving box 902 drives the rotary drum 903 to enable the caterpillar band 904 to rotate, vegetables are poured in from the feed inlet 10, the rotary drum 15 in the feed inlet 10 enables the vegetables to rotate in the feed inlet 10 to shake out attached large-particle dirt, the vegetables enter the caterpillar band 904 and are separated by the baffle 905 to avoid accumulation, the water injection pipe 5 conveys a water source to the water inlet 2 to wash the vegetables through the high-pressure spray head 4 connected with the connecting pipe 3, the water source can flow into the machine seat 1 to enter the water storage tank 7 for reuse, and water recycling is achieved.
